Background: Neoadjuvant chemoimmunotherapy (NACI) is promising for resectable nonsmall cell lung cancer (NSCLC), but predictive biomarkers are still lacking. The authors aimed to develop a model based on pretreatment parameters predict major pathological response (MPR) such an approach. Methods: enrolled operable NSCLC treated with NACI between March 2020 and May 2023 then collected baseline clinical-pathology data routine laboratory examinations before treatment. efficacy safety of this cohort was reported variables were screened by Logistic Lasso regression nomogram developed. In addition, receiver operating characteristic curves, calibration decision curve analysis used assess its power. Finally, internal cross-validation external validation performed the power model. Results: total, 206 eligible patients recruited in study 53.4% (110/206) achieved MPR. Using multivariate analysis, constructed seven variables, prothrombin time (PT), neutrophil percentage (NEUT%), large platelet ratio (P-LCR), eosinophil (EOS%), smoking, type, programmed death ligand-1 (PD-L1) expression finally. had good discrimination, area under (AUC) 0.775, 0.746, 0.835 all datasets, cross-validation, validation, respectively. curves showed consistency, indicated potential value clinical practice. Conclusion: This real world revealed favorable NACI. proposed multiple clinically accessible could effectively MPR probability be powerful tool personalized medication.

Abstract Background: Cigarette smoke exposure has been linked to systemic immune dysfunction, including for B-cell and immunoglobulin (Ig) production, poor outcomes in patients with ovarian cancer. No study evaluated the impact of across life-course on infiltration Ig abundance tumors. Methods: We measured markers B plasma cells isotypes using multiplex immunofluorescence 395 cancer tumors Nurses’ Health Study (NHS)/NHSII. conducted beta-binomial analyses evaluating odds ratios (OR) 95% confidence intervals (CI) positivity by cigarette among cases Cox proportional hazards models evaluate hazard (HR) CI developing low (<median) or high (≥median) cell/Ig percentage. Results: There were no associations between IgM Among cases, we observed higher IgA+ ever smokers (OR, 1.54; CI, 1.14–2.07) parental 2.03; 1.18–3.49) versus never smokers. Women not had risk IgG+ (HR, 1.51; 1.10–2.09), whereas a lower 0.74; 0.56–0.99). Conclusions: Ever smoking was associated increased IgA Impact: improved outcomes, suggesting that although is cancer, it may lead tumor immunogenicity.

Dendritic cells (DCs) are professional antigen-presenting that traditionally divided into two distinct subsets: myeloid DCs (mDCs) and plasmacytoid (pDCs). pDCs known for their ability to secrete large amounts of cytokine type I interferons (IFN- α). In our previous work, we have demonstrated pDC infiltration promotes glioblastoma (GBM) tumor immunosuppression through decreased IFN-α secretion via TLR-9 signaling increased suppressive function regulatory T (Tregs) IL-10 secretion, resulting in poor overall outcomes mouse models GBM. Further dissecting the mechanism pDC-mediated GBM immunosuppression, this study, identified CCL21 as highly upregulated by multiple cell lines, which recruit sites CCL21-CCR7 signaling. Furthermore, activated microenvironment intracellular β-arrestin CIITA. Finally, found CCL21-treated directly suppress CD8+ proliferation without affecting differentiation, is considered canonical pathway immunotolerant regulation. Taken together, results show play a multifaced role could be novel therapeutic target overcome immunosuppression.
